Commit Graph

  • 5a4b2ce38c idsueyesrc: fix config-file path handling on Linux fehlfarbe 2020-05-12 01:00:19 +02:00
  • 5ad3820ef4 update README to clarify GStreamer 1.8 is needed for KLV support Joshua M. Doe 2020-04-16 07:52:47 -04:00
  • c1aa0a49af
    doc: update Linux instructions and discuss KLV joshdoe 2020-04-15 13:15:35 -04:00
  • a6e97d08df klv: make KLV support optional via ENABLE_KLV, disabled by default Joshua M. Doe 2020-04-15 12:34:03 -04:00
  • feca1a7969 idsueye: include lowercase filename to fix build on Linux yair 2020-04-15 11:34:57 +03:00
  • 26e05b7058 build: allow overriding installation directories Joshua M. Doe 2020-04-15 09:11:40 -04:00
  • 2a8fc2f84d build: use a better default install location on Linux Joshua M. Doe 2020-04-15 07:13:52 -04:00
  • 7adc8d9ac9 freeimage: disable plugin for now, as it hasn't been ported to 1.0 yet Joshua M. Doe 2020-04-15 09:22:28 -04:00
  • 3af98f0a65 added lowercase to Build dir ignore yair 2020-04-15 15:03:36 +03:00
  • 5a3d31e0f2 Add build dir to gitignore yair 2020-04-15 10:23:33 +03:00
  • 5cf3cb23eb Update FindIDSuEye.cmake yair 2020-04-14 20:10:53 +03:00
  • 6a9b31c7d4 build: avoid policy CMP0053 warnings On Windows there's an environment variable with parentheses, avoid the CMake warning Joshua M. Doe 2020-04-14 15:58:23 -04:00
  • 59715529c7 build: only install PDBs on Windows Joshua M. Doe 2020-04-14 14:57:34 -04:00
  • 4ebc6b8c77 build: consistently have libgst prefix on all plugins Joshua M. Doe 2020-04-14 15:30:46 -04:00
  • 6c87791b95 build: reduce warnings from Phoenix cmake module Joshua M. Doe 2020-04-14 14:32:01 -04:00
  • 6ea2d4325e build: update Pylon to build on Linux Joshua M. Doe 2020-04-14 14:31:44 -04:00
  • 3b556f3357 build: fix find_package call to use right case of NIIMAQdx Joshua M. Doe 2020-04-14 14:31:11 -04:00
  • bb17f75edc genicam: disable building, incomplete anyways Joshua M. Doe 2020-04-14 12:39:09 -04:00
  • 5c811d9b79 klv: allow building with older versions of GStreamer Joshua M. Doe 2020-04-14 12:38:36 -04:00
  • 663269e9a6 klv: add export macro for gcc Joshua M. Doe 2020-04-14 12:37:17 -04:00
  • 529d5788f9 build: avoid error of Pleora isn't installed Joshua M. Doe 2020-04-14 11:24:14 -04:00
  • ef66205b40 pylonsrc: avoid memcpy by wrapping buffer Joshua M. Doe 2020-04-08 11:42:55 -04:00
  • 2a07d3df60 pylonsrc: use caps negotiation for selecting PixelFormat instead of property Joshua M. Doe 2020-04-08 06:58:07 -04:00
  • 9bf84eb7e8 common: add genicam pixel format utility function Joshua M. Doe 2020-04-08 06:50:12 -04:00
  • 0606ad67b3 pylonsrc: refactor _start Joshua M. Doe 2020-04-07 11:43:59 -04:00
  • 3d074be9a0 pylonsrc: add YUV422_YUYV_Packed as YUY2 video format Joshua M. Doe 2020-04-07 06:54:04 -04:00
  • e43d708bec pylonsrc: add pixel format YUV422Packed Joshua M. Doe 2020-04-06 15:22:11 -04:00
  • c2648dc66b add LICENSE file Joshua M. Doe 2020-04-06 15:13:43 -04:00
  • 1a6891858f update README to include Basler Pylon Joshua M. Doe 2020-04-06 15:08:05 -04:00
  • aabe7bdeaf pylonsrc: use standard LOG and DEBUG macros Joshua M. Doe 2020-04-06 14:59:25 -04:00
  • 2099e46e72 pylonsrc: move global variables to be instance variables Joshua M. Doe 2020-04-06 14:51:17 -04:00
  • c0f68e83d3 pylonsrc: merge Basler Pylon plugin from gst-pylonsrc Joshua M. Doe 2020-04-06 14:35:50 -04:00
  • 552fae8538 pleora: run gst-indent Joshua M. Doe 2020-03-19 11:44:09 -04:00
  • fa07ad8263 pleorasink: check all IP addresses on each interface Joshua M. Doe 2020-03-19 11:43:01 -04:00
  • e886b5f4fa klvinject: use unix reference timestamp if available Joshua M. Doe 2020-03-06 14:44:15 -05:00
  • 8830751c52 aptinasrc: add xsdat-file property to allow sensor file override Joshua M. Doe 2020-03-06 14:20:41 -05:00
  • 8ff872e634 bayerutils: add new plugin with bayer2gray, to do caps conversion Joshua M. Doe 2020-02-27 10:11:53 -05:00
  • 37aaea1022 build: newer Aptina SDK drops the _64 library suffix Joshua M. Doe 2020-02-27 09:59:31 -05:00
  • 2692036550 aptinasrc: add support for Bayer Joshua M. Doe 2020-02-27 09:58:53 -05:00
  • d00aec86a5
    doc: add compilation instructions joshdoe 2020-03-17 10:51:21 -04:00
  • 293d74ccc0 doc: update README.md to mention pleorasink, extractcolor, and klv elements Joshua M. Doe 2020-02-07 09:32:40 -05:00
  • fc4c7887a3 pleora: avoid compiler warning messages Joshua M. Doe 2020-02-06 13:36:47 -05:00
  • ec20592591 klv: add klv library, klvinject and klvinspect elements Joshua M. Doe 2020-02-06 13:33:56 -05:00
  • 1502c7fa9c pleorasink: add auto-multicast property Joshua M. Doe 2019-11-22 14:33:54 -05:00
  • a92281c965 pleora: add support for sending/receiving KLV metadata as chunk data Joshua M. Doe 2019-11-21 11:47:42 -05:00
  • f6509a1b4d pleorasink: fix debug level, add more interface debug output Joshua M. Doe 2019-11-15 10:30:50 -05:00
  • 7292eaf353 pleora: build for various versions of eBUS, and append version to plugin name Joshua M. Doe 2019-11-07 08:31:27 -05:00
  • 0fc4bc182c imperxsdi: add direct conversion to v210 pixel format Joshua M. Doe 2019-11-06 14:24:20 -05:00
  • 995bcca23b pleorasink: add GigE Vision sink for eBUS GEV Tx API Joshua M. Doe 2019-10-31 10:53:23 -04:00
  • 64dc597e42 pleorasrc: search for eBUS SDK in PUREGEV_ROOT first Joshua M. Doe 2019-10-30 14:54:12 -04:00
  • d705291cbd imperxflexsrc: fix timestamps Joshua M. Doe 2019-10-30 14:51:39 -04:00
  • b500b4b24b imperxflexsrc: support packed pixel formats Joshua M. Doe 2019-10-30 14:42:51 -04:00
  • 79a5e67de0 pleorasrc: lock streaming related parameters during acquisition Joshua M. Doe 2019-10-24 10:29:17 -04:00
  • 91e060dcbd pleorasrc: read GEV packet size after negotiation Joshua M. Doe 2019-10-23 15:06:16 -04:00
  • 6084edb3f7 pleorasrc: refactor device/stream opening Joshua M. Doe 2019-10-23 15:04:08 -04:00
  • 4b03de07fe pleorasrc: allow config file to specify only one of stream or device Joshua M. Doe 2019-10-22 12:26:01 -04:00
  • 76e67ee5fc pleorasrc: set caps before _create to avoid bad negotiation Joshua M. Doe 2019-10-21 11:58:15 -04:00
  • 88f7a82818 pleorasrc: cache caps if width, height, and pixel type don't change Joshua M. Doe 2019-10-21 11:50:28 -04:00
  • 19ce118c96 pleorasrc: add config-file and config-file-connect properties Joshua M. Doe 2019-10-21 11:00:24 -04:00
  • e4ae64b44b pleorasrc: add packet-size property Joshua M. Doe 2019-10-17 14:58:37 -04:00
  • 351aab12d8 pleorasrc: add more and better useful error feedback to user Joshua M. Doe 2019-10-17 14:37:37 -04:00
  • a045f24efa
    Merge pull request #7 from 5shekel/patch-1 joshdoe 2019-11-07 09:16:21 -05:00
  • fa24f0e437
    Update gstidsueyesrc.c yair 2019-11-07 15:56:07 +02:00
  • 865eed1c46
    add more instructions and examples to README.md joshdoe 2019-10-10 08:47:24 -04:00
  • 685b202541 select: new filter to drop frames based on offset and skip Joshua M. Doe 2019-10-10 07:49:56 -04:00
  • 8b7b405381 pleorasrc: add support for IYU1 and IYU2 pixel formats Joshua M. Doe 2019-10-10 07:38:52 -04:00
  • 5839020c33 gigesimsink: allow compiling with GStreamer < 1.10 Joshua M. Doe 2019-10-10 07:36:51 -04:00
  • 73708059f6 gigesimsink: new sink for A&B Soft GigESim to produce GigE Vision video Joshua M. Doe 2019-10-09 10:52:50 -04:00
  • ef1242fd81 pleorasrc: run gst-indent Joshua M. Doe 2019-10-02 10:58:17 -04:00
  • e1d0574ecf pleorasrc: more useful error messages Joshua M. Doe 2019-10-02 10:58:01 -04:00
  • a7f4657547 pleorasrc: add support for compiling against eBUS SDK 5 Joshua M. Doe 2019-10-02 10:55:24 -04:00
  • 5ef38d0833 kayasrc: support opening multiple cameras from one frame grabber Joshua M. Doe 2019-10-02 09:39:05 -04:00
  • 75aaec26b6 kayasrc: add UNIX epoch reference timestamp for absolute timestamping Joshua M. Doe 2019-10-02 09:35:39 -04:00
  • 1611f54672 niimaqdxsrc: don't over-report dropped frames Joshua M. Doe 2019-10-02 09:32:43 -04:00
  • 8fd7c91da6 niimaqdxsrc: add UNIX epoch reference timestamp for absolute timestamping Joshua M. Doe 2019-10-02 09:31:02 -04:00
  • 11bb336ee4 niimaqsrc: add UNIX epoch reference timestamp for absolute timestamping Joshua M. Doe 2019-10-02 09:17:05 -04:00
  • 54f9df72b7 imperxflex,extractcolor,niimaq: change plugin name to match module Joshua M. Doe 2019-10-02 09:06:01 -04:00
  • fb9072bc8b build: make sure kaya and genicam PDBs are put in the right zip Joshua M. Doe 2019-09-30 10:28:04 -04:00
  • e364cfe4d5 pleorasrc: fix handling of strides that aren't 32-bit aligned Joshua M. Doe 2019-08-29 14:56:18 -04:00
  • 64866758a2 "pleorasrc: open devices by default in unicast mode Joshua M. Doe 2019-08-29 12:26:36 -04:00
  • d68f26619a add more supported sources in README.md Joshua M. Doe 2019-08-01 14:48:30 -04:00
  • 2ee4399f3f imperxsdisrc: new source element for IMPERX HD-SDI Express framegrabbers Joshua M. Doe 2019-08-01 12:25:23 -04:00
  • 477ae0b9d7 imperxflex: move imperxflexsrc to a more unique directory Joshua M. Doe 2019-07-26 10:44:06 -04:00
  • 904546b7e2 niimaqdxsrc: fix endianness for Mono14 big endian Joshua M. Doe 2019-04-15 10:43:39 -04:00
  • 68e7fb1c00 niimaqdxsrc: ignore spaces in format names Joshua M. Doe 2019-03-25 14:42:07 -04:00
  • 85b4e242ca kayasrc: issue warning when exposure time value is invalid Joshua M. Doe 2019-03-25 14:32:07 -04:00
  • 4e18c58e19 kayasrc: add property to allow command execution after opening camera Joshua M. Doe 2019-03-25 14:31:32 -04:00
  • b6d837aed4 misbirunpack: add properties to allow tweaking luma and chroma mask Joshua M. Doe 2018-10-04 13:10:47 -04:00
  • bcb80f3b87 pleorasrc: run gst-indent Joshua M. Doe 2018-10-04 13:05:17 -04:00
  • 5546ea432a pleorasrc: avoid releasing buffer if pipeline is destroyed Joshua M. Doe 2018-10-04 13:02:47 -04:00
  • cde7de8b97 pixcisrc: only use format-file if specified, ignoring format-name Joshua M. Doe 2018-10-02 07:36:53 -04:00
  • 9142674df2 misbirunpack: add shift and swap property for non-compliant sources Joshua M. Doe 2018-08-14 12:54:48 -04:00
  • f238398851 kayasrc: xml file existence bug fix Joshua M. Doe 2018-07-18 15:17:18 -04:00
  • 760620b21a kayasrc: use grabber PixelFormat in case format conversion is being used Joshua M. Doe 2018-07-18 10:54:09 -04:00
  • 73725a57da common: add some RGB pixel formats to genicam conversion Joshua M. Doe 2018-07-18 10:53:32 -04:00
  • 4c47870c00 kayasrc: report dropped frames with warning and bus message Joshua M. Doe 2018-07-18 08:51:13 -04:00
  • e7cdcb426d kayasrc: add exposure-time property Joshua M. Doe 2018-07-17 15:10:06 -04:00
  • 3e7230e782 genicamsrc: fix device-index property installation Joshua M. Doe 2018-07-10 14:52:47 -04:00
  • 5e6a0eea99 pleorasrc: add RGBa8 support as RGBx Joshua M. Doe 2018-07-10 14:42:40 -04:00
  • 2588c7b836 pleorasrc: fix detection-timeout property Joshua M. Doe 2018-07-10 14:42:27 -04:00